1. Who Benefits from Nonoperative Gallstone Therapy

Nonoperative gallstone therapy is a viable option for select patients with cholesterol stones confined to the gallbladder and who want to avoid anesthesia or have meaningful surgical risk. In practice, the best candidates are small stones in patients who can commit to long-term therapy and careful monitoring. This approach is not universal, and candidacy hinges on stone characteristics and overall health.

  • Stone type and size criteria: cholesterol stones, typically small (<5-10 mm) and solitary, respond best to dissolution therapy.
  • Patient factors: high surgical risk due to age or comorbidities, pregnancy, or a strong preference to avoid an operation.
  • Anatomy and expectations: no evidence of bile duct stones, no acute inflammation, and imaging suggests the gallbladder is still a functional reservoir.

Dissolution therapy is not a universal solution. It is most effective when stones are small, cholesterol-based, and the patient has no complications. Pigment stones or stones associated with gallbladder inflammation do not respond well, and dissolving one stone does not prevent others from forming later. Realistic expectations matter: dissolution, if it occurs, unfolds over months, and stopping therapy often leads to recurrence.

2. Medications for Stone Dissolution

Dissolution therapy with ursodeoxycholic acid is limited to a subset of patients with small cholesterol stones and a functioning gallbladder. In practice, candidates typically have stones under about 5–10 mm, no bile duct obstruction, and stones that are predominantly cholesterol rather than pigment. The medication is UDCA dosed at 8–10 mg/kg per day in divided doses, with adjustments based on tolerance and liver function tests. Treatment runs for months to years, and stones tend to dissolve slowly on serial ultrasounds while symptoms improve. Importantly, dissolution does not guarantee permanent clearance; stopping therapy commonly leads to recurrence and may necessitate eventual surgery.   • Dosing: Ursodeoxycholic acid (UDCA) is typically prescribed at 8–10 mg/kg/day, in divided doses, with adjustments for liver function and GI tolerance.
  • Duration & Monitoring: Expect a sustained course of months to years; use serial ultrasound to confirm dissolution and periodic LFTs to detect adverse effects.
  • Limitations & Contraindications: Not effective for pigment stones or calcified stones; not suitable with bile duct obstruction or ongoing biliary infection; there is a meaningful chance of stones returning after therapy ends.

3. When Surgery Is the Clear Choice

When symptoms or complications point to surgery, the path forward is clear: surgical removal of the gallbladder (cholecystectomy) offers definitive relief for symptomatic gallstones. In Dhaka, that means moving beyond trial-and-error medical therapy when stones are causing ongoing pain or dangerous complications. Surgical indications and approach

  • Symptomatic biliary colic with imaging-proven stones that disrupt daily life and where pain relief is not achieved with medical therapy alone.
  • Acute cholecystitis with gallbladder wall inflammation and clinical signs of infection.
  • Gallstone pancreatitis or biliary obstruction requiring definitive management.
  • Gallbladder disease with stones not expected to respond to dissolution therapy due to stone size, composition, or recurrence risk.
  • Suspicion of bile duct stones requiring definitive clearance or staged endoscopic therapy before removal.

At Popular Medical College Hospital, the preferred method is laparoscopic cholecystectomy. It offers small incisions, less pain, and a rapid return to normal activity. In most cases, patients go home within 24 hours and resume ordinary life within a week, depending on intraoperative findings and your recovery plan.

Not all cases fit a textbook path. Complex inflammation, prior abdominal surgery, or unusual gallbladder anatomy can necessitate an open approach or careful intraoperative decisions to protect bile ducts. In experienced hands, conversion to open surgery remains uncommon, and the goal stays the same: remove the diseased organ safely and minimize risk to the bile ducts.

4. The Diagnostic Pathway: From Imaging to Decision

The diagnostic pathway for gallstones starts with disciplined imaging and ends with a treatment decision. In Dhaka, ultrasound is the gatekeeper: it identifies stones, gauges gallbladder status, and flags ductal disease. Those findings, interpreted in the context of a patient’s symptoms and comorbidities, drive the next step and are reviewed with Dr Arefin at Popular Medical College Hospital. Testing proceeds along a few clear pathways. If ultrasound shows a small stone with a noninflamed gallbladder, nonoperative management may be considered in carefully selected patients under supervision. If there are signs of inflammation or obstruction, the plan shifts toward surgery or more advanced imaging to map the ducts.

  • Ultrasound as the gatekeeper: stone burden, gallbladder wall thickness, pericholecystic fluid, and bile duct dilation guide the next step.
  • Functional imaging when needed: a HIDA scan assesses gallbladder function when ultrasound findings are equivocal or symptoms persist without clear inflammation.
  • CBD evaluation when indicated: MRCP or endoscopic evaluation is considered if labs or symptoms raise concern for stones in the common bile duct.

Laboratory tests complement imaging. Liver enzymes and bilirubin patterns help distinguish obstruction from inflammation, while amylase or lipase flags pancreatitis. In an acute presentation with fever, leukocytosis, or marked right upper-quadrant pain, the pathway leans toward surgical management; if labs are stable and imaging shows limited disease, nonoperative options may stay on the table under close follow-up.

Important: The decision hinges on a synthesis of findings, not a single test. A hepatobiliary surgeon’s review ensures the plan aligns with stone type, anatomy, and local resource realities.

Key decision triggers: symptomatic biliary events, gallbladder inflammation, pigment or large stones, and evidence of biliary obstruction. When CBD stones are unlikely and stones are small, medical management may be considered with close monitoring, but persistent or complex cases usually proceed to surgery.

7. Long-Term Outlook and Lifestyle

Your long-term outlook with gallstone management hinges on the path you choose today. If you pursue nonoperative gallstones treatment options, you gain temporary relief but carry recurrence risk and possible progression that eventually pushes you toward surgery. If you have the gallbladder removed, most people enjoy durable symptom relief, but the road isn't zero-risk, and some patients still need monitoring for bile duct issues or digestive changes.

After laparoscopic cholecystectomy at Popular Medical College Hospital under Dr Arefin, most patients recover quickly, yet you should expect a period of dietary adjustment as your bile flow adapts to the absence of the reservoir. Some people notice looser stools or fat intolerance temporarily, which usually improves over weeks.

  • Maintain a healthy weight gradually and avoid rapid weight loss, which can destabilize bile chemistry and trigger new stones.
  • Adopt a diet low in saturated fats and refined carbohydrates and high in fiber to support digestion and overall metabolic health.
  • Stay active with regular exercise; aim for about 150 minutes per week and gentle strength work to preserve muscle mass during recovery.
  • Monitor symptoms and seek evaluation promptly if recurrent biliary pain, jaundice, or unusual digestion returns after treatment.
